{site_name}

{site_name}

🌜 搜索

在PHP中,json_last_error_msg()函数用于获取最后一个JSON编解码操作的错误信息

php 𝄐 0
php json_encode,普惠普及是什么意思,php json,php json转数组,php json字符串转json对象,php json转字符串
在PHP中,json_last_error_msg()函数用于获取最后一个JSON编解码操作的错误信息。
这个函数的用法是调用json_last_error()函数获取错误码,然后将错误码传递给json_last_error_msg()函数来获取具体的错误信息。

下面是一个示例:
php
$jsonData = '{"name":"John","age":30,"city":"New York"}';

// 将JSON字符串解码为PHP数组
$arrayData = json_decode($jsonData, true);

// 检查是否有解码错误
if (json_last_error() != JSON_ERROR_NONE) {
// 获取解码错误的具体信息
$errorMsg = json_last_error_msg();

// 输出错误信息
echo $errorMsg;
}


在这个示例中,我们将一个JSON字符串解码为PHP数组。如果解码过程中出现错误,我们使用json_last_error_msg()函数获取错误信息,并将其打印出来。